The Mauser Type B was a commercial sporting version of the Mauser 98 action marketed to civilian hunters and sportsmen. It represents the bridge between military Mauser production and the commercial sporting Mauser that would dominate bolt-action sporting rifle design for a century. Type: Rifle Action: Bolt-Action Caliber: 8x57mm Capacity: 5 Year introduced: 1898, Germany Weight: 88 oz Overall length: 43.7" Status: Discontinued Intended use: Hunting, Collecting
